Modern construction is changing fast, and modular construction is leading this change. Instead of building everything on-site, modular buildings are made in factories in sections and then assembled at the site. This method saves time, reduces cost, and improves quality. Because of these benefits, modular building manufacturers are becoming very important in today’s construction industry.
Modular construction is now used for homes, offices, schools, hospitals, hotels, and industrial buildings. With better technology and design, modular building manufacturers are creating strong, safe, and modern structures that match traditional buildings in look and performance.
Why Modular Construction is Growing
Modular construction is popular because it offers many advantages:
- Projects finish much faster
- Less material waste
- Lower labor and construction costs
- Better quality control in factory conditions
- More eco-friendly than traditional methods
These benefits make modular construction a smart choice for modern developers and governments.

How Modular Building Manufacturers Are Changing Construction
Modular building manufacturers are making construction smarter and faster:
- Factory work avoids weather delays
- Better quality through controlled production
- Faster building handover
- Lower carbon footprint
- Safer working conditions
Because of this, many developers now prefer modular buildings over traditional construction.
